Output d724240d687f5e2c304642d26c6be3290999d67b283378dd38e5446a3b91e701: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8109ed213253cbdc88d1e67819060d42ac30c258 OP_EQUAL
address
3DTJyypUBDSTvAU7yG4ax7a5wnjVPGzoxp
transaction
d724240d687f5e2c304642d26c6be3290999d67b283378dd38e5446a3b91e701
confirmations
489934
spent
true